## Quillbase Search Environments

The Quillbase nightly reindex runs in the staging and production environments on separate schedules to avoid overlapping load. The reindex worker reads from the primary document store, rebuilds the inverted index, and swaps aliases atomically. Access is restricted to the indexing service account; no human credentials are involved. For review purposes, the staging environment mirrors production settings except for scale. The relevant configuration values for the reindex worker are listed below.

config for kafof-bawef:
holath:
  log_level: debug
  metrics_host: metrics.holath.qorvelsys.internal
  pin: 2191
  pool_size: 32

Before tagging the Sweepwright release, confirm the orphaned-resource sweeper dry-run output against the staging inventory in Corvid Cloud. The sweeper only deletes volumes and snapshots unclaimed for 14 days; anything younger is logged and skipped. Review the deletion manifest diff in the PR, then approve the reaper job config. Once approved, the release bundle must be signed before the scheduler will accept it. Sign with the key below.

signing key of fahof-tahof = bky13_rpcUNgEnLB4i2

Internal Memo — Reseller Programme Refresh

Sales leads: the Brightquill reseller programme gets a facelift next month. Tiered margins replace the flat 15%, and we're capping partners per region to reduce channel conflict. Onboarding packs ship next week; certifications move online. Flag any partner concerns to me before launch. Confidential background on the wider plan sits just below.

confidential, fajop-fajef: Soriusax Foods plans to lower the Rusix list price by 43.2 percent in December. The steering committee signed off on a budget of $74.0 million for Project Oliion. The renewal with Brivanix Works closes at $118.6 million a year, 43.4 percent above the last contract. Project Ulaiel slips by six weeks because of the audit delay.